Legal guidelines and the university policy dictate that personally identifying information, including ID numbers, may not be sent visible in an email. Link to the full information security policy – Here
Every email sent from a Savion account will be scanned by an InfoSec system for such personally identifying information.
In cases where an email includes content (including an attachment) with 2 or more ID numbers, a warning\recommendation will be sent to put the ID numbers in an encrypted attachment.
The proper way to send ID numbers is to put them in a file, and encrypt the file with a password. The password must not be included in the email, but rather sent through a separate medium (phone call, SMS, WhatsApp message, etc.)
